语音合成:自然交互时代的核心引擎
2025.09.23 11:09浏览量:0简介:本文探讨语音合成技术如何推动自然交互发展,从技术演进、应用场景到挑战与解决方案,揭示其作为人机交互核心引擎的潜力与价值。
语音合成:自然交互时代的核心引擎
引言:从机械音到情感化交互的跨越
语音合成(Text-to-Speech, TTS)技术历经数十年发展,已从早期机械单调的电子音进化为具备情感表达能力的自然语音。这一变革不仅重塑了人机交互的边界,更成为构建自然交互生态的核心引擎。在智能客服、车载系统、无障碍辅助等场景中,高质量的语音合成能力直接决定了用户体验的优劣。本文将从技术演进、应用场景、挑战与解决方案三个维度,深入探讨语音合成如何驱动自然交互的未来。
一、技术演进:从规则驱动到深度学习的范式革命
1.1 规则驱动时代:参数化合成的局限
早期语音合成基于规则驱动模型,通过拼接预先录制的音素片段实现语音生成。此类方法(如PSOLA算法)虽能保证语音的清晰度,但存在机械感强、情感表达匮乏的缺陷。例如,传统TTS系统在生成疑问句时,仅能通过调整音高参数模拟疑问语气,但无法捕捉人类语言中的微妙情感变化。
1.2 深度学习时代:端到端模型的突破
2016年后,基于深度神经网络的端到端TTS模型(如Tacotron、FastSpeech)成为主流。这类模型通过编码器-解码器架构直接学习文本到语音的映射关系,显著提升了语音的自然度。以FastSpeech 2为例,其通过引入音高、能量等声学特征预测模块,可生成包含停顿、重音等韵律特征的语音:
# FastSpeech 2 伪代码示例
class FastSpeech2(nn.Module):
def __init__(self):
self.text_encoder = TransformerEncoder() # 文本编码器
self.duration_predictor = DurationPredictor() # 音素时长预测
self.pitch_predictor = PitchPredictor() # 音高预测
self.decoder = TransformerDecoder() # 语音解码器
def forward(self, text):
# 1. 编码文本并预测音素时长
encoder_output = self.text_encoder(text)
duration = self.duration_predictor(encoder_output)
# 2. 预测音高、能量等声学特征
pitch = self.pitch_predictor(encoder_output)
energy = self.energy_predictor(encoder_output)
# 3. 解码生成梅尔频谱
mel_spectrogram = self.decoder(encoder_output, duration, pitch, energy)
return mel_spectrogram
此类模型通过大规模数据训练,可生成接近人类发音水平的语音,甚至支持多语言、多方言的混合输出。
1.3 情感化与个性化:从“能听”到“爱听”
当前研究前沿聚焦于情感化语音合成与个性化语音定制。通过引入情感标签(如愤怒、喜悦)或用户声纹特征,系统可生成具有特定情感或用户专属风格的语音。例如,微软Azure Speech SDK提供的SSML(语音合成标记语言)支持通过<prosody>
标签控制语速、音调,通过<mstts:express-as>
标签指定情感类型:
<speak version="1.0" xmlns="https://www.w3.org/2001/10/synthesis" xml:lang="en-US">
<voice name="en-US-JennyNeural">
<mstts:express-as type="cheerful">
Hello! How can I assist you today?
</mstts:express-as>
</voice>
</speak>
二、应用场景:自然交互的生态构建
2.1 智能客服:从“机器应答”到“情感共鸣”
在金融、电商等领域,智能客服需通过语音传递专业性与亲和力。某银行部署的情感化TTS系统,通过分析用户对话情绪动态调整语音风格(如用户愤怒时切换为温和语调),使客户满意度提升30%。
2.2 车载系统:安全与体验的双重优化
车载场景对语音交互的实时性、抗噪性要求极高。某车企采用的低延迟TTS引擎,可在100ms内生成导航指令,同时通过空间音频技术模拟声源方位(如“前方500米右转”从右侧扬声器输出),显著降低驾驶分心风险。
2.3 无障碍辅助:打破沟通壁垒
语音合成是无障碍技术的重要组成部分。某视障辅助APP集成多语言TTS功能,支持用户通过语音导航、阅读文档,甚至通过调整语速、音调适应不同听力需求,使信息获取效率提升5倍。
三、挑战与解决方案:通往自然交互的最后一公里
3.1 实时性与资源消耗的平衡
端到端TTS模型虽效果优异,但计算复杂度高。解决方案包括:
3.2 情感表达的精细化控制
当前情感化TTS仍存在情感类型有限、过渡生硬的问题。研究方向包括:
- 多模态融合:结合文本语义、用户历史对话等多维度信息生成更自然的情感语音。
- 强化学习:通过用户反馈数据优化情感表达策略。
3.3 隐私与伦理:数据使用的边界
语音合成需处理大量用户语音数据,隐私保护至关重要。建议:
- 本地化部署:在终端设备完成语音生成,避免数据上传。
- 差分隐私:对训练数据添加噪声,防止用户声纹特征被逆向还原。
四、未来展望:自然交互的终极形态
随着技术演进,语音合成将向以下方向发展:
- 全双工交互:结合语音识别与合成,实现类似人类的连续对话能力。
- 多模态融合:与唇形同步、手势识别等技术结合,构建沉浸式交互体验。
- 通用语音引擎:支持任意文本、任意语言、任意情感的“一站式”语音生成。
结语:自然交互的基石
语音合成技术正从“工具”进化为“交互生态的核心”。对于开发者而言,选择支持情感化、低延迟、多语言的TTS框架(如Mozilla TTS、Coqui TTS)是构建自然交互应用的关键;对于企业用户,需关注语音合成的可定制性(如品牌语音定制)、合规性(如GDPR)及与现有系统的集成能力。未来,随着AI技术的深化,语音合成将彻底模糊人机交互的边界,开启一个“所想即所言,所言即所达”的自然交互新时代。
发表评论
登录后可评论,请前往 登录 或 注册